According to this law, the amount of electricity passing through a conductor between two points in a circuit is directly proportional to the voltage across the two points, for a particular temperature. Advertisements Ohm expressed his idea in the form of a simple equation, E = IR, which ...

Ohm's lawOhm's law is used to describe the relationship between Voltage (V), Current (I) and Resistance (R). If you know any of two of these values it is possible to calculate the third. Ohm's law can be arranged in the following three ways depending on what you want to calculate...
